Annual Awards 1975

The Maud Smith Bequest for the outstanding act of lifesaving in 1975 has been awarded to Coxswain/Mechanic David Kennett of Yarmouth, Isle of Wight, for the rescue on September 14 of the crew of five of the yacht Chayka of Ardgour. Coxswain Kennett was awarded the Institution's silver medal for this service.

The Ralph Glister Award for the most meritorious service by the crew of an ILB in 1975 has been awarded to Helmsman Michael Coates and Crew Member David Wharton of Whitby for the rescue on July 25 of a man cut off on a cliff by the tide. For this service Helmsman Coates was awarded the Institution's bronze medal and Crew Member Wharton the thanks of the Institution inscribed on vellum.

The James Michael Bower Fund. Monetary awards from this fund are being made to the three men who received the RNLI's silver medal for gallantry for services during 1975: Coxswain Frank Bloom of Walton and Frinton; Coxswain/Mechanic David Kennett of Yarmouth; and Coxswain/Mechanic Arthur Liddon of Dover..
